Wayne Marshall

Research AssociateChicago, IL

Manhattan Project VeteranProject Worker/Staff

Wayne Marshall was a research associate at the University of Chicago’s Metallurgical Laboratory (“Met Lab”) during the Manhattan Project. According to the Journal of Glenn T. Seaborg, Vol. 2, he was assigned to spectrographic work in George Boyd’s Purification Group (p. 2).
